'The New King of Comedy' is a 2019 Chinese comedy-drama film directed, written, and produced by Stephen Chow. It is a remake of Chow's own 1999 film 'King of Comedy', this time set in Mainland China with different characters.

The film tells the story of a young woman who is dreaming and striving to pursue the actors' dream despite being an extra and stand-in. It was released in China on 5 February 2019 during the Lunar New Year 2019. With a budget of $8 million (US) along with few months of filming and post-production, it is believed to be the smallest project of Chow's career as a filmmaker.

Production



Stephen Chow began writing the film in 2015. Filming began in October 2018 and lasted only a few weeks.

For the movie, Chow cast people who could relate to the life of a struggling actor. He intentionally sought out Wang to play the male lead role, due to the latter's experience in working as an extra early in his career. Actress E Jingwen also worked as an extra prior to 'The New King of Comedy', similar to the character she played in the film.

Chow recruited the Chinese girl group J fng sho n , whose members were eliminated in the Chinese version of Produce 101, to sing the film's theme song.
